Transaction 584dba821f2fcefbdf969ec36e65288b1899637751e0d541b64a91bb5a8c4a06

1 Input
2 Outputs
  • 584dba821f2fcefbdf969ec36e65288b1899637751e0d541b64a91bb5a8c4a06:0
  • value  5935056
    address  15zHSuu55SWkH9X4gQfDDwURCztR7FXC6k
  • 584dba821f2fcefbdf969ec36e65288b1899637751e0d541b64a91bb5a8c4a06:1
  • value  499527
    address  bc1qc440lvjusrw6a80lpcu2n02pudk0p7803y6nv7